Actual girls are contradictory, says Rasika Dugal
Rasika Dugal is returning to the world of ‘Mirzapur’, reprising her function because the shrewd and much-discussed Beena Tripathi aka Beena Bhabhi in ‘Mirzapur: The Film’. In a current interview, the actress opened up about what continues to attract her to the character and the way the franchise’s feminine characters have expanded the way in which power and femininity are portrayed on display screen.
Beena Tripathi has lengthy divided opinion amongst ‘Mirzapur’ followers, admired by some for her crafty, criticised by others for her manipulative streak. For Dugal, that very complexity is what makes the character price revisiting. She advised ‘Mid-Day’, “What drew me to Beena is that she refuses to suit right into a neat field. She always adapts, negotiates energy, makes tough selections and surprises each the viewers and herself. That makes her way more fascinating to play than somebody who’s written to look ‘sturdy’ in each scene.”
Dugal added that returning to the character within the movie has been particularly rewarding: “Revisiting Beena in ‘Mirzapur: The Film’ has been rewarding as a result of the writing offers audiences the chance to see her past binaries.”
Dugal additionally spoke extra broadly about how the franchise’s feminine characters have pushed again in opposition to a singular concept of what a ‘sturdy lady’ ought to appear like on display screen.
She defined, “Power, by itself, can’t be the one defining trait of a lady. Actual girls are contradictory. They are often susceptible one second and strategic the following; they are often compassionate and make morally questionable decisions on the identical time.”
‘Mirzapur: The Film’ marks the franchise’s first theatrical outing, following three profitable seasons on ‘Amazon Prime Video’ because the present’s 2018 debut. Directed by Gurmmeet Singh and written by sequence creator Puneet Krishna, the movie brings again the present’s principal forged, together with Pankaj Tripathi and Ali Fazal and marks the much-anticipated return of Divyenndu. Rasika Dugal reprises her function as Beena Tripathi, alongside Shweta Tripathi Sharma, Shriya Pilgaonkar, Abhishek Banerjee, Sheeba Chaddha and others. The movie is scheduled for a nationwide theatrical launch on September 4, 2026, earlier than streaming on ‘Prime Video’ after an eight-week theatrical window.
